Read the two scenarios given below and identify the Entities and then identify Attributes related to these entities and hence draw the Entity Relationship Diagram (ERD) in both cases given below.

a) A company has a number of employees having their name, address and date of birth. The company has several projects having a code, description and start date. Some employees are given salary one hourly based work with fixed per hour rate while other are one payroll and have fixed per month salary plus residence allowance. Each employee is assigned one or more projects and he may not be assigned to any project. A project must have at least one employee and may have more than one employees assigned.
b) A laboratory has several chemists who work on various projects and who may use certain kind of equipment on each project, there are also different chemicals involved in a project that a chemist may use chemicals have a name, number and the quantity. Chemist has a name and phone number, while project has an id and start date. Equipment can have a number and its price.
